About the role

The Hampton Sheriff’s Office seeks a Lieutenant to join our team in a key leadership role responsible for supervising correctional facility operations during an assigned shift. The Lieutenant provides operational oversight, leads Sergeants and Deputies, and ensures a safe, secure, and professional environment for inmates, staff, and the public.

Responsibilities

  • Supervise Sergeants and Deputies during assigned shifts
  • Oversee daily correctional operations and inmate supervision
  • Conduct facility inspections, review reports, and ensure compliance
  • Lead emergency response efforts and critical incident management
  • Train, mentor, and evaluate staff performance
  • Manage staffing schedules, assignments, and operational readiness
  • Ensure adherence to policies, accreditation standards, and legal requirements
  • Maintain safety, security, and order within the facility

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ree from an accredited four-year college or university in criminal justice, social science, administration, or a related field.
  • Equivalent combination of education and directly related experience may be considered instead of the preferred degree.
  • A minimum of four (4) years of supervisory experience in a correctional or law enforcement environment.
  • Must successfully pass a background investigation before employment or promotion.
  • This position is safety sensitive and subject to alcohol and controlled substance testing in accordance with City policy.
  • Must possess and maintain a valid driver’s license with a satisfactory driving record based on City of Hampton criteria.

Qualifications

  • Must qualify to carry and use firearms pursuant to 53.1-29 of the Code of Virginia and DCJS standards.
  • The incumbent may be considered “essential personnel” during citywide emergencies or at the direction of the City Manager or designee, which may include long hours and unusual schedules.
